Quote: People want the prestige that having a college provides but I don't see the facts that this area can support a college or that the college is doing much for this area.

How much can the college do, when the local gov't seems more interested in bringing in tourism than industry? You don't need a college degree for most of the seasonal (tourism) work.

But it's a Catch-22. Industry wants an educated base for its employees, but educational establishments need the industry to employ graduates to offer the courses industry wants for potential employees. So if an industry that wants educated employees isn't already in the area, it's unlikely one will move in.
